Magickally definition, meaning and origin

Magickally is a term that refers to the use of magic or supernatural powers in a particular action or event. It is often used to describe something that has an otherworldly or mystical quality to it.

The word “magickally” is derived from the word “magic,” which has a long history of association with the supernatural and the occult.

In modern usage, the term “magick” is often used to describe the practice of manipulating energies or forces in the universe in order to achieve a desired outcome. This can be done through various techniques such as spells, rituals, and other forms of ceremonial practice.

It’s important to note that “magickally” is not a commonly used term in mainstream English and may not be recognized by everyone. It is more commonly used within certain subcultures or communities that are interested in magic, witchcraft and the occult.
